Business Society’s Market Outlook for Soda Ash on August 18, 2026: Volatile

ECHEMI 2026-08-19

On August 17, 2026, the market price of heavy soda ash in China remained stable at 1,090 CNY per ton. The average difference over 20 days rebounded compared to the previous day, while the 5-day and 10-day average differences remained stable, with the difference indicators showing a resistance to decline warning signal. The current price is at a low point in the 1-year, 3-month, and 60-day cycles, with limited room for further decline. Subsequent attention should be paid to the demand release from downstream industries such as glass and baking soda, as well as the supply situation of upstream raw materials. The latest available data is up to August 17, 2026, and it is recommended to refer to real-time data.

II. Signal State Determination

Three moving average differences do not change in a completely consistent direction (5-day and 10-day moving average differences are flat, while the 20-day moving average difference is rising), which is consistent with the characteristics of a resilience warning (bullish) signal.

Three, Conclusions on Trend Directions

The price trend is volatile (with a bullish bias in terms of resistance to decline), for the following reasons:

1. Mean difference indicator level: The 5-day and 10-day mean differences remain stable, while the 20-day mean difference has rebounded from the previous day. The trends are not entirely consistent, which aligns with the resistance to decline warning judgment in a volatile market under the mean difference method. 2. Spot price level: The price of heavy soda ash on the day remained stable at 1090 CNY/ton, with the price at a low point over multiple cycles, having strong support below and limited room for decline.

Four, Spatial Reference

The price levels for heavy-grade soda ash—on 1-year, 3-month, and 60-day cycles—are all at low levels, with limited room for further decline. If downstream demand picks up, a temporary rebound could occur.
